In American and Canada 3 teaspoons = 1 tablespoon In Australia and the UK 4 teaspoons = 1 tablespoon 22 divided by 3 = 7 tablespoons 1 teaspoon 22 divided by 4 = 5 tablespoons 2 teaspoons

There are approximately 6 to 7 teaspoons of garlic powder in an ounce. This conversion can vary slightly depending on the density of the garlic powder, but as a general guideline, you can use this range for cooking and recipes.
